Abstract
본 발명은 자동차후방의 소정위치에 후속차량과의 거리를 감지하는 거리감지센서를 설치하여 후속차량이 안전거리범위내로 진입하였다고 판단되는 경우 정지등을 자동으로 점등시켜 후속차량의 운전자에게 경각심을 일깨워주기 위한 후속차량의 안전거리미확보시 정지동자동구동장치에 관한 것으로, 차량의 속도에 제동을 가할 수 있는 제도수단으로서의 브레이크(10)와, 운전자의 브레이크(10) 조작과 동시에 점등되는 정지등(22)을 갖춘 차량에서 현재 주행중인 차량의 차속을 검출하는 차속검출부(12)와, 상기 차속검출부(12)에서 검출되는 차속에 따른 후속 차량에 대한 기준안전거리가 미리 저장되어 있는 기준안전기리데이터기억부(14), 상기 차속검출부(12)에서 검출된 차속을 기초로 하여 후속차량과의 안전거리범위내로 적외선발광소자(16a)로부터 적외선을 방사하여 후속차량에 부딪혀 반사되는 적외선을 적외선수광소자(16b)에서 수광하는 거리감지부(16), 상기 적외선발광소자(16a)에서 방사되는 적외선의 양을 조절하는 광량조절신호를 출력함과 더불어 적외선수광소자(16b)에 수광되는 적외선이 있을 경우 후속차량에세 안전거리를 확보하도록 경고발생신호를 출력하는 제어부(18), 상기 제어부(18)에서 출력되는 경고발생신호에 따라 정지등(22)을 구동시키는 정지등구동부(20)를 구비하여 구성된 것이다.The present invention is to install a distance sensor to detect the distance to the next vehicle at a predetermined position in the rear of the car to automatically turn on the stop light when it is determined that the next vehicle has entered the safe distance range to wake up the driver of the next vehicle The present invention relates to a stop driving automatic drive device when a safety distance of a subsequent vehicle to be given is not secured, and to a brake 10 serving as a drawing means capable of braking the speed of the vehicle, and a stop light which is turned on simultaneously with the driver's brake 10 operation. Reference safety memory data storage in which the vehicle speed detection unit 12 that detects the vehicle speed of the vehicle currently being driven in the vehicle having a) and the reference safety distance for the subsequent vehicle according to the vehicle speed detected by the vehicle speed detection unit 12 are stored in advance 14, the infrared light emitting element 16a within the safety distance range with the subsequent vehicle based on the vehicle speed detected by the vehicle speed detection unit 12 Outputting a light amount control signal for adjusting the amount of infrared rays emitted from the infrared light emitting device 16a, the distance sensing unit 16 for receiving infrared rays reflected by a subsequent vehicle by radiating infrared rays; In addition, if there is infrared light received by the infrared light receiving element 16b, the control unit 18 outputs a warning signal to ensure a safe distance for subsequent vehicles, and stop light according to the warning signal output from the control unit 18 ( 22 is configured to include a stop light driving unit 20 for driving.
